It is well knwon that structural phase transformations in solids are classified into two groups with respect to the necessity of atom diffusion for the transformation: diffusionless transformation and diffusion controlled one. Martensitic transformation, which occurs in many Fe-, Cu- and Ti-based alloys and ceramics, is one of the most typical examples of the former type of the transforamtions, and has been widely studied in order to know its characteristics from physical, metallographical, crystallographical and technological points of view.
